In the context of construction work, prioritizing durability and impact resistance in a helmet is crucial for ensuring the safety of workers. Construction sites often expose individuals to potential hazards such as falling objects, debris, or accidental bumps against hard surfaces, which can lead to serious head injuries. A helmet that is built with durable materials and has a high impact-resistance rating is designed to absorb and dissipate energy from such impacts, thereby protecting the wearer’s head.

While factors like lightweight materials, cost efficiency, and fashionable design may contribute to comfort or aesthetic appeal, they do not compromise the primary function of the helmet, which is to provide adequate protection. A well-designed helmet that emphasizes durability and impact resistance is the foundation of a safety program on the construction site, and it's essential for minimizing the risk of head injury. Ultimately, the strength and resilience of the helmet must come first to ensure that workers can rely on their protective equipment in hazardous environments.
